Cyberlink PowerDirector

Cyberlink PowerDirector is a powerful yet easy-to-use video editing software designed for creators of all skill levels. It provides a comprehensive suite of tools for producing high-quality video projects for various purposes, from social media content to professional-grade films. by Cyberlink

Shotcut

Shotcut is a free, open-source, and cross-platform video editor offering a wide array of features for both beginners and experienced users. Supporting numerous formats and providing non-linear editing, it's a powerful tool for video creation without watermarks or license fees. by Meltytech

Cyberlink PowerDirector

Cyberlink PowerDirector

Analysis & Comparison

Advantages

User-friendly interface suitable for beginners.
Comprehensive feature set covering basic and advanced editing.
Good performance, especially with hardware acceleration.
Strong color correction and grading tools.
Effective green screen capabilities.

Limitations

Some bundled effects can appear outdated.
Licensing options require careful consideration.
Mastering advanced features may require learning.
Shotcut

Shotcut

Analysis & Comparison

Advantages

Completely free and open source with no watermarks.
Cross-platform compatibility (Windows, macOS, Linux).
Wide range of supported formats through FFmpeg.
Robust non-linear editing capabilities with multiple tracks.
Extensive collection of filters and effects with keyframe animation.

Limitations

Can have a steeper learning curve for absolute beginners.
Interface design might feel less polished than commercial alternatives.
Performance can vary depending on hardware and project complexity.
